Macclesfield FC return to league action this Saturday as we make the journey over to Nottinghamshire to take on fellow play off rivals Worksop Town. 

Michael Clegg’s side will be looking to remain on a high after last Saturday’s FA Trophy victory over Coalville Town.

Worksop came away 2-1 victors from the Leasing.com Stadium back in October and will be hoping to complete a league double over The Silkmen.

The Tigers currently sit 8th in the Northern Premier League table.
